Understanding the Surge in Demand for Water-Resistant Audio

In an era where our electronics are extensions of our lifestyles, the demand for durable, high-quality audio has moved beyond the living room. Water-resistant small speakers are no longer a niche product for the adventurous few; they have become a mainstream essential. The shift is driven by a confluence of trends: the rise of remote work and “work-from-anywhere” cultures, the increased value placed on outdoor recreation, and the seamless integration of music into daily activities like cooking, showering, or lounging by the pool. Consumers now expect their audio gear to keep pace with their dynamic lives, transitioning effortlessly from a kitchen counter to a beach blanket without a second thought.
Market data underscores this movement. A recent report from Grand View Research (2023) valued the global Bluetooth speaker market at USD 7.02 billion in 2022, with a projected compound annual growth rate (CAGR) of 12.3% from 2023 to 2030. A significant portion of this growth is attributed to the rugged and waterproof segment. Furthermore, a Consumer Technology Association survey (2024) indicated that over 65% of new Bluetooth speaker purchasers cite water resistance as a “must-have” or “highly important” feature, up from just 42% five years prior. Key Features to Decipher When Choosing Your Speaker
Navigating the specifications of small water-resistant speakers requires understanding a few critical technologies and ratings. Here’s what truly matters:
1. IP Ratings: The Code to Water and Dust Defense
The Ingress Protection (IP) code is your most objective guide. It’s a two-digit standard (e.g., IP67). The first digit (0-6) rates solid particle/dust protection. The second digit (0-9K) rates liquid protection. For most users:
- IPX7: Can be immersed in up to 1 meter of fresh water for 30 minutes. Ideal for poolside, shower, or kayaking.
- IP67: Fully dust-tight and can handle the same immersion as IPX7. Perfect for beach trips and dusty trails.
- IP68: Dust-tight and can withstand continuous immersion beyond 1 meter (conditions specified by the manufacturer). The gold standard for serious outdoor use.
- IPX4 or IP54: Resists splashes from any direction. Good for kitchen use or workouts, but not for submersion.
2. Beyond Water: Build Quality & Ruggedness
Look for mentions of military-grade standards like MIL-STD-810H, which indicates testing for drops, shocks, vibration, and extreme temperatures. A rubberized exterior, reinforced corners, and a sturdy grille are visual indicators of a robust build.
3. Sound Performance in a Small Package
Size constraints challenge engineers, but innovations abound. Key terms include:
- Passive Radiators: These unpowered diaphragms vibrate to enhance bass response without requiring a large enclosure.
- 360-Degree Sound: Drivers positioned to disperse audio uniformly, ideal for group settings.
- Stereo Pairing: The ability to wirelessly link two identical speakers for a true left-right stereo soundstage.
4. Battery Life & Connectivity
Advertised battery life (e.g., “12 hours”) is often measured at 50% volume. Real-world use may differ. USB-C charging is now the expected standard, with some models offering wireless Qi charging pads on their surface. Bluetooth 5.3 or higher provides better range, stability, and lower power consumption. Multipoint connectivity, allowing the speaker to switch between two devices (like a phone and a laptop), is a highly convenient premium feature.

Maximizing Your Investment: Usage Tips and Lifespan Extension
Owning a rugged speaker is about freedom, but proper care ensures it lasts for years.
- Post-Water Exposure: After submersion or exposure to saltwater/chlorinated water, rinse the speaker with fresh water and dry it thoroughly with a soft cloth before charging. Pay special attention to ports.
- Charging Best Practices: Use the provided cable or a certified high-quality alternative. Avoid leaving the speaker plugged in continuously for weeks. For long-term storage, maintain a charge around 50%.
- Firmware Updates: Regularly update your speaker’s firmware via its companion app. Manufacturers often release updates that improve sound profiles, connectivity, and battery management.
- Cleaning: Use a soft, slightly damp cloth. Never use harsh chemicals, solvents, or high-pressure water jets, even on a highly-rated speaker, as this can damage seals over time.
The Future of Portable Audio: What’s Next?
The trajectory for small water-resistant speakers points toward greater intelligence and integration. We are already seeing the rise of integrated voice assistants (Google Assistant, Alexa, Siri) without needing a constant phone link. Matter protocol support may soon allow these portable speakers to act as smart home nodes. Furthermore, advances in spatial audio and head-tracking technologies, currently in headphones, could trickle down to portable speakers for a more immersive personal listening zone. Professional Q&A: Your Technical Questions Answered
Q1: Is a speaker with an IP67 rating safe to use in the shower or at the beach?
에이: Yes, an IP67 rating is excellent for both environments. It is fully dust-tight (protecting against sand) and can withstand immersion in 1 meter of water for 30 minutes, making it more than capable of handling shower steam, splashes, and being submerged in a pool or shallow seawater. However, always rinse it with fresh water after exposure to salt or chlorine to prevent long-term corrosion on the metal grille.
Q2: Does Bluetooth version (5.2 vs. 5.3) really make a difference in audio quality and connection?
에이: The Bluetooth version primarily affects stability, range, and power efficiency, not the core audio quality (which is dictated by the codec, like SBC, AAC, or LDAC). Bluetooth 5.3 offers more reliable connections in congested wireless environments (like parks or apartments), slightly better range, and improved power management for longer battery life. For most users, the difference between 5.2 and 5.3 in daily use is subtle but meaningful for overall performance.
Q3: Can I truly get “studio-quality” or “Hi-Res” sound from a small, waterproof Bluetooth speaker?
에이: While physics limits the absolute fidelity possible from a small enclosure, the gap is closing. Many premium small speakers now support advanced codecs like LDAC (990 kbps) 또는 aptX Adaptive, which can transmit significantly more audio data than the standard SBC codec. When paired with well-tuned drivers and passive radiators, the result is sound quality that is rich, detailed, and satisfying for all but the most critical listening sessions. For true hi-res audio, however, a wired connection to larger, powered speakers or headphones is still superior.
Q4: How long should I realistically expect the battery in a premium water-resistant speaker to last before significant degradation?
에이: Most lithium-ion batteries in quality speakers are rated for 300-500 full charge cycles before capacity drops to about 80% of original. With typical use (charging every few days), this translates to 2-3 years of maintaining good performance. You can extend this lifespan by avoiding constant 0%-100% cycles; occasional partial charges are better for long-term battery health. Some brands, like Sonos, offer user-replaceable battery services to extend the product’s life further.
